#!/usr/bin/env python3
|
|
"""LLM judge for prompt/instruction quality.
|
|
Uses the user's existing CLI tool for evaluation.
|
|
DO NOT MODIFY after experiment starts — this is the fixed evaluator."""
|
|
|
|
import json
|
|
import subprocess
|
|
import sys
|
|
from pathlib import Path
|
|
|
|
# --- CONFIGURE THESE ---
|
|
TARGET_FILE = "prompt.md" # Prompt being optimized
|
|
TEST_CASES_FILE = "tests/cases.json" # Test cases: [{"input": "...", "expected": "..."}]
|
|
CLI_TOOL = "claude" # or: codex, gemini
|
|
# --- END CONFIG ---
|
|
|
|
JUDGE_PROMPT_TEMPLATE = """You are evaluating a system prompt's effectiveness.
|
|
|
|
SYSTEM PROMPT BEING TESTED:
|
|
{prompt}
|
|
|
|
TEST INPUT:
|
|
{input}
|
|
|
|
EXPECTED OUTPUT (reference):
|
|
{expected}
|
|
|
|
ACTUAL OUTPUT:
|
|
{actual}
|
|
|
|
Score the actual output on these criteria (each 1-10):
|
|
1. ACCURACY — Does it match the expected output's intent and facts?
|
|
2. COMPLETENESS — Does it cover all required elements?
|
|
3. CLARITY — Is it well-structured and easy to understand?
|
|
4. INSTRUCTION_FOLLOWING — Does it follow the system prompt's guidelines?
|
|
|
|
Output EXACTLY: quality_score: <average of all 4>
|
|
Nothing else."""
|
|
|
|
try:
|
|
prompt = Path(TARGET_FILE).read_text()
|
|
except FileNotFoundError:
|
|
print(f"Target file not found: {TARGET_FILE}", file=sys.stderr)
|
|
sys.exit(1)
|
|
|
|
try:
|
|
test_cases = json.loads(Path(TEST_CASES_FILE).read_text())
|
|
except FileNotFoundError:
|
|
print(f"Test cases file not found: {TEST_CASES_FILE}", file=sys.stderr)
|
|
sys.exit(1)
|
|
|
|
scores = []
|
|
|
|
for i, case in enumerate(test_cases):
|
|
# Generate output using the prompt
|
|
gen_prompt = f"{prompt}\n\n{case['input']}"
|
|
gen_result = subprocess.run(
|
|
[CLI_TOOL, "-p", gen_prompt],
|
|
capture_output=True, text=True, timeout=60
|
|
)
|
|
if gen_result.returncode != 0:
|
|
print(f"Generation failed for case {i+1}", file=sys.stderr)
|
|
scores.append(0)
|
|
continue
|
|
|
|
actual = gen_result.stdout.strip()
|
|
|
|
# Judge the output
|
|
judge_prompt = JUDGE_PROMPT_TEMPLATE.format(
|
|
prompt=prompt[:500],
|
|
input=case["input"],
|
|
expected=case.get("expected", "N/A"),
|
|
actual=actual[:500]
|
|
)
|
|
|
|
judge_result = subprocess.run(
|
|
[CLI_TOOL, "-p", judge_prompt],
|
|
capture_output=True, text=True, timeout=60
|
|
)
|
|
|
|
if judge_result.returncode != 0:
|
|
scores.append(0)
|
|
continue
|
|
|
|
# Parse score
|
|
for line in judge_result.stdout.splitlines():
|
|
if "quality_score:" in line:
|
|
try:
|
|
score = float(line.split(":")[-1].strip())
|
|
scores.append(score)
|
|
except ValueError:
|
|
scores.append(0)
|
|
break
|
|
else:
|
|
scores.append(0)
|
|
|
|
print(f" Case {i+1}/{len(test_cases)}: {scores[-1]:.1f}", file=sys.stderr)
|
|
|
|
if not scores:
|
|
print("No test cases evaluated", file=sys.stderr)
|
|
sys.exit(1)
|
|
|
|
avg = sum(scores) / len(scores)
|
|
quality = avg * 10 # 1-10 scores → 10-100 range
|
|
|
|
print(f"quality_score: {quality:.2f}")
|
|
print(f"cases_tested: {len(scores)}")
|
|
print(f"avg_per_case: {avg:.2f}")
